It's a podcast of contrasting moods, as Charlie and Jake's conversation surrounding Bowie and Dylan in 2004 alternates between somber/bittersweet and zesty/nugget-filled. Dylan releases his "autobiography" Chronicles Vol. 1, which is met with great fanfare by other writers whose own work they recognize. Look for Volumes 2 and 3 coming to a store near you, never! Bowie continues his biggest tour ever, replete with Bon Jovi Comeback Hair (patent pending), healthy, well-nurtured skin, rippling abs, heaping helpings of cool dad confidence, and maybe a tasteful mash-up along the way. Will Dylan succumb to the Plagiarist Police? Will Bowie have a scary health scare that inadvertently restores his mystery? WHO WINS THE POINTS? Only the Chief Commander knows on this edition of Bowie Vs. Dylan.

Jake struggles to impart the weight of history as Dylan has his most monumental and important year since 1975 with the release of his universally acclaimed studio album "Time Out of Mind". Marvel at how Charlie manages to hijack Bob's victory lap by giving credence (and more alarmingly, POINTS) to Bowie's endless stream of singles from that same year. The brothers bicker like it's actually 1997, but nonetheless share a special moment when identifying the components of late 90's industrial techno music videos. The completely arbitrary points are shockingly close; who will win, by how much, and at what personal cost?

Jake and Charlie discuss Dylan crooning his way through the 27 minute magnum opus Nashville Skyline, while Bowie releases his minor novelty single, "Space Oddity", and spends the remainder of his second self-titled album trying to imitate a Bob that Bob himself had already moved past. Bowie mimes his way onto the scene while Bob gets busy making the one truly great creative contribution that he ever managed to muster: the conception and virgin birth of his 5th child and pop music's truest heir, Jakob Dylan of the still wildly relevant band, The Wallflowers, playing a casino near you.
